Single Umbrella Stroller

Being a new parent is stressful enough without having to carry a stroller for the entire day. Single umbrella strollers are a great option for parents who want an easy to use lightweight pushchair.

These lightweight travel options fold up easily and compactly with only one hand. Some offer higher handles for parental comfort and larger canopy with windows that can be seen from afar as well as reclining seats and adult cup holders.

Features

A single umbrella stroller is a great option for parents looking to reduce their baby gear, and save space in their home or apartment home or save money. This type of stroller is usually ideal for commuting, travel or for short day trips because it usually lacks the more advanced features of standard strollers. Another thing to take into consideration is the frame's height and angle of the handles. The majority of umbrella strollers are made with a low frame, and have no telescoping handles, which can be difficult for parents who are taller. The G-Luxe model from UPPAbaby takes the idea to a new level by providing a high frame and an angled handle. This means that your feet won't get caught in the bar between the lower wheels when you walk, which can be a common problem with umbrella strollers designed for taller parents.

A single umbrella stroller is a simple lightweight option. It's perfect for days when you don't want to carry around a larger pram or when you're traveling and Www.9324874.Xyz need something quick to get in and out of airports as well as public transport. It's great for quick day trips as well as parents who don't want to invest in a full sized stroller.

Umbrella strollers are so named because of their folding mechanism, which can make them resemble an umbrella when they are compacted. These strollers are known for their ease of usage, but they are not made for rough surfaces. They are best suited to babies who can sit upright and are not suitable for infants. Check the manufacturer's recommendations for your baby's weight and age before using an umbrella stroller.

One of the most important aspects to look for in an umbrella stroller is how easily it folds. Some models can be folded in just a few seconds. This is essential for parents who are busy. If you're looking for strollers that are easy to fold and lightweight for travel take a look at a single umbrella stroller. These pushchairs are referred to because of the curved handle, which looks like an umbrella when closed. They fold into small and compact packages that can be placed in your car or suitcase.

Umbrella strollers are typically inexpensive and bare-bones in terms of features with the exception of a small sunshade. They are ideal for short trips or use when you don't need to carry a large stroller.

However, they're not your ideal choice for an extended day of sightseeing or if you live on a bumpy or uneven street or sidewalk. In these cases, you might prefer a stroller with a suspension system for a smoother ride and to stop those annoying scraping noises.
